| #if !(defined(__ARM_ARCH_6__) || defined(__ARM_ARCH_6J__) || defined(__ARM_ARCH_6Z__) || defined(__ARM_ARCH_6K__) || defined(__ARM_ARCH_6ZK__))
 | |
| // ARMv7 and later have dmb instruction
 | |
| #define BOOST_ATOMIC_DETAIL_ARM_HAS_DMB 1
 | |
| #endif
 | |
| 
 | |
| #if !(defined(__ARM_ARCH_6__) || defined(__ARM_ARCH_6J__) || defined(__ARM_ARCH_6Z__))
 | |
| // ARMv6k and ARMv7 have 8 and 16 ldrex/strex variants
 | |
| #define BOOST_ATOMIC_DETAIL_ARM_HAS_LDREXB_STREXB 1
 | |
| #define BOOST_ATOMIC_DETAIL_ARM_HAS_LDREXH_STREXH 1
 | |
| #if !(((defined(__ARM_ARCH_6K__) || defined(__ARM_ARCH_6ZK__)) && defined(__thumb__)) || defined(__ARM_ARCH_7M__))
 | |
| // ARMv6k and ARMv7 except ARMv7-M have 64-bit ldrex/strex variants.
 | |
| // Unfortunately, GCC (at least 4.7.3 on Ubuntu) does not allocate register pairs properly when targeting ARMv6k Thumb,
 | |
| // which is required for ldrexd/strexd instructions, so we disable 64-bit support. When targeting ARMv6k ARM
 | |
| // or ARMv7 (both ARM and Thumb 2) it works as expected.
 | |
| #define BOOST_ATOMIC_DETAIL_ARM_HAS_LDREXD_STREXD 1
 | |
| #endif
 | |
| #endif
